Crypto Market Ends 2025 on a Low Note

The crypto market’s downward trend continued today, with total market capitalization falling 3.17% over the past month amid persistent sell-offs. The decline is a disappointing end to 2025, a year that had promised much for the crypto space. Despite the overall market downturn, one sector has bucked the trend: tokenized real-world assets (RWAs).

Tokenized Real-World Assets Defy the Trend

The distributed asset value of RWAs has continued to climb, reaching a new all-time high despite unfavorable market conditions. This is a remarkable achievement, considering the overall market sentiment. RWAs have been gaining traction in recent months, with many investors seeing them as a more stable and secure alternative to traditional cryptocurrencies.

Bitcoin Sell-Off Continues

Meanwhile, the Bitcoin sell-off continues, with the world’s larg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ization falling 5% over the past week. The decline is part of a larger trend, with Bitcoin’s price having fallen by over 20% in the past month. The sell-off is attributed to a variety of factors, including increased regulatory scrutiny and a decline in investor sentiment.
